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#C7ABBD is classified in the Register under the Rose Color Family, with Low Saturation and Very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(199, 171, 189) — 78% red, 67.1% green, 74.1%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 0 / 11 / 4 / 22.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#C7ABBD presents itself as a gently muted pink-red rose — one that has a delicate, washed-out lightness. It is a natural fit for airy backdrops, whitespace-heavy designs and gentle gradients. In The Official Register of Color Names it is practically indistinguishable from Lily (#C8AABF). Slightly further away sit Alluring (#C4ABB9) and Maverick (#C8B1C0).

Technically, the mix leans on its red channel (rgb(199, 171, 189)), which gives #C7ABBD its character. On this background, black text reaches a 10.0: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AAA); white stays at 2.1:1. #C7ABBD has no official name yet. #C7ABBD color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.
